Main growing regions
The white turnip is grown in areas with loose, cool, well-watered soil, favouring good root development:
Gharb - Kenitra: mass production, very good quality.
Doukkala - El Jadida: fine, even texture, great regularity.
Fès - Meknès: seasonal harvest, good dry matter content.
Souss-Massa: winter cultivation under cover, guaranteed earliness.
Marrakech - Haouz: additional production at the end of the season.
Harvest: from November to Aprildepending on the zone.
